Some artists (a lot of artists, actually) make a Christmas CD, but when Earth Mama makes a Christmas CD, she really makes a Christmas CD!. Earth Mama is Joyce Rouse. Ms. Rouse has released a CD of ten original songs, most written by Earth Mama herself, all very impressive.
Though her music is unique, there were times when Earth Mama's arrangements reminded me of Anne Murray songs; her voice, of Karen Carpenter, and her lyrics of Christine Lavin. Her songs are romantic, sentimental, and sweet. Her arrangements have a richness to them, no doubt due to the full complement of instrumentalists and backing vocalists she used. Stylistically, the songs hew to the thin line between country and pop, though it would be possible also to classify it as contemporary folk.
The song I enjoyed the most was The Angel Tree. It's story brought tears to my eyes (though it is also true I had been burning hickory and walnut in the chiminea all morning). The liner notes say this song was co-written with Ruth Hummel during the period from 1991-2003, so it has been in the making for a long time. In fact, the ten songs that make up Christmas Heart have been written during the same period. That she would wait until an album's worth of songs were written before making the album is indicative of an artist who has the patience to spend the time and effort to get things exactly right. And she has gotten things right on Christmas Heart. Both musically and lyrically, all ten songs are "keepers". Earlier, Ms. Rouse had sent me another of her CDs, Under the Rainbow (a packaging error that worked to my benefit), and I had noticed the same thing. She is a very careful songwriter, singer, and producer. The production values of both CDs are very high.
Not only that, both Earth Mama records are the sort of music that is more enjoyable every time it is played. So, if you are in the mood for some serious Christmas music, but you've heard one too many rock and roll versions of Silent Night, you could do a lot worse than listen to Earth Mama's Christmas Heart.
